The restaurant is quite spacious and nicely decorated with Thai inspired pieces.
They have this really cool area for larger groups where you can sit without your shoes – if that makes sense.
I find the area to be versatile for different group sizes.


Panang Curry
This curry is absolutely delicious and Nichole would agree.
It’s creamy, with a hint of coconut and has nice chunks of juicy chicken.


Pad Thai
Is a classic Thai dish that I always lean to and love to eat.
This particular dish I wished came with lime and a bit more flavor.
The noodles appeared to be a bit sticker than usual.
It was a bit average compared to the curry.


Fried Banana with Coconut Ice Cream
Yay! I love dessert. I really enjoyed the warm fried banana with the cool sensation of ice cream.
However, the coconut ice cream reminded me a lot of I think of a soap scent. So I think next time I’d opt for vanilla.

Overall, I would recommend checking out the curries at Amarin Thai.
I had a pleasant experience, nice service and moderate price points.

Shezan has a lovely interior design. It’s got a golden cast atmosphere with gorgeous modern feel chandeliers. Ha perfect date place! We were seated immediately and the server was quite attentive. I suppose it because we ate earlier dinner because the restaurant had just re-opened for supper. Another thing to note is that on their door they have sign that says they have $10 lunch buffet. Shezan dinner prices range from $7-12.
You can also purchase naan and rice as a la carte items like we did.

Mango Lassi – Yogurt & Mango Fruit Drink

I really liked the mango lassi I ordered as had a strong mango flavor. However it is a very thick drink so it can be quite filling by itself.

Regular Naan – bread
It was good but nothing special.

Basmati Rice


Matta Paneer (Vegetarian, cheese, peas)
It was a very creamy sauce. However there’s wasn’t much paneer cheese in the mixture. Nevertheless this was a way better rendition then the one I had at the Yahoo cafeteria so I was quite pleased with the outcome.


Chicken Tikka Masala (a classic chicken curry dish)
First off, I love to eat chicken so I had to try their chicken tikka masala. Their waitress even recommended it. Overall I liked it. It had nice flavor, taste and texture. It wasn’t too spicy (ha thank goodness to my intolerance of spice).

The entrees were a decent size and it was filling meal. We even had some curry leftovers to take home. I think I would love to come back to try their lunch special.
